public class KrbIdentity extends Object
| Constructor and Description |
|---|
KrbIdentity(String principalName) |
| Modifier and Type | Method and Description |
|---|---|
void |
addKey(EncryptionKey encKey) |
void |
addKeys(List<EncryptionKey> encKeys) |
boolean |
equals(Object obj) |
KerberosTime |
getCreatedTime() |
KerberosTime |
getExpireTime() |
int |
getKdcFlags() |
EncryptionKey |
getKey(EncryptionType encType) |
Map<EncryptionType,EncryptionKey> |
getKeys() |
int |
getKeyVersion() |
PrincipalName |
getPrincipal() |
String |
getPrincipalName() |
int |
hashCode() |
boolean |
isDisabled() |
boolean |
isLocked() |
void |
setCreatedTime(KerberosTime createdTime) |
void |
setDisabled(boolean disabled) |
void |
setExpireTime(KerberosTime expireTime) |
void |
setKdcFlags(int kdcFlags) |
void |
setKeyVersion(int keyVersion) |
void |
setLocked(boolean locked) |
void |
setPrincipal(PrincipalName principal) |
void |
setPrincipalName(String newPrincipalName) |
public KrbIdentity(String principalName)
public String getPrincipalName()
public void setPrincipalName(String newPrincipalName)
public PrincipalName getPrincipal()
public void setPrincipal(PrincipalName principal)
public KerberosTime getExpireTime()
public void setExpireTime(KerberosTime expireTime)
public KerberosTime getCreatedTime()
public void setCreatedTime(KerberosTime createdTime)
public boolean isDisabled()
public void setDisabled(boolean disabled)
public boolean isLocked()
public void setLocked(boolean locked)
public void addKey(EncryptionKey encKey)
public void addKeys(List<EncryptionKey> encKeys)
public Map<EncryptionType,EncryptionKey> getKeys()
public EncryptionKey getKey(EncryptionType encType)
public int getKdcFlags()
public void setKdcFlags(int kdcFlags)
public int getKeyVersion()
public void setKeyVersion(int keyVersion)
Copyright © 2014–2017 The Apache Software Foundation. All rights reserved.